OverviewLocated between the squares Postplatz and Theaterplatz, the Zwinger palace in Dresden is a magnificent architectural accomplishment and is thoroughly explored in this guide. Presenting it as the epitome of Baroque exuberance, the guide demonstrates how its unique design makes it one of the greatest creations of 18th-century European art, earning it a respected place in art history as an outstanding monument of the period. Delving into the important museums it houses today such as the Old Masters Picture Gallery, the porcelain collection, and the Royal Cabinet of Mathematical and Physical Instruments, this is the ideal reference to the Zwinger's eventful past as well as the fascinating era in which it was built.
